Click here to show the map

Leaving Slough Train Station


📝 Submit Review ❔ Ask a Question 📍 Map

🚩 Report this page

Companies and places nearby

show phones

What hotels, hostels and apartments are located near Leaving Slough Train Station?

List of nearest hotels:

Rivington Serviced Apartments located at Rivington Apartments, Railway Terrace, 103 meters northeast.

Grays Place Apartment located at Flat 44, The Junction, Grays Place, 115 meters northeast.

Lexington Apartment Slough located at 42 Lexington Apartment, Railway Terrace, 128 meters east.

Holiday Inn Express Slough three stars hotel located at Mill Street, 144 meters east.

Grey Zebra Apartments Slough five stars hotel located at Apartment 43 Cornwall House 55/57 High Street, 410 meters southwest.

Luxury Service apartment - Near Heathrow located at Mosaic Apartments, 26 High street, 449 meters southwest.

Westminster House located at 31-37 Windsor Road Flat 3, 609 meters southwest.


You can find and book more hotels, hostels and apartments in our interactive hotel map

Nearby cities, towns and villages

Reviews by country